Gawd Awful Posted October 6, 2012 Share Posted October 6, 2012 I'm hoping someone has a clue. I let my wife barrow my 87 last week, again and today, about half way through the match it started giving her problems. when I looked at it I realized the shell Lifter wasn't staying up. as soon as you release fwd pressure on the lever, the lifter falls before the shell is pushed into the chamber. It's a fun gun and worked flawlessly the few times I've used it since I got it back from Lassiter. I plan on calling him next week but was hopping someone on the wire had an Idea or experience with this problem and could help me out. thanks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
C.C. Dollar, SASS #62609 Posted October 6, 2012 Share Posted October 6, 2012 ...Well...my guess would be the magazine spring is broken, too weak or perhaps you took the "plug" out. All that holds the lifter up is the pressure from the plunger provided by the magazine spring. Had that problem with my original doing a little junior gun smithing. Hope that helps... C.C. Dollar Oh...(edit)...if the spring is weak just add a wood plug (dowel) in front of the magazine to give the spring the proper pressure...cut to desired length. Gawd Awful Posted October 7, 2012 Author Share Posted October 7, 2012 sure enough, had a piece of dirt wedged in and holding the plunger back far enough that the lifter wasn't touching it. cleaned out the crud and it works again. thanks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
